Superstar LeBron James has etched his name in NBA history by becoming the first player ever to score 40,000 points. This remarkable achievement solidifies James’ status as one of the greatest basketball players of all time.
LeBron James’ milestone of reaching 40,000 points is a testament to his unparalleled talent, dedication, and longevity in the NBA.
